在轻量应用服务器 2核4G(CPU内存)的配置下,同时运行两个网站是否“卡”,主要取决于以下几个因素:
✅ 一、你的网站类型和访问量决定性能是否够用
1. 静态网站(HTML/CSS/JS)
- 比如:简单的个人博客、企业展示页
- 资源消耗低
- 两个这样的网站放在同一台 2核4G 的服务器上 基本不会卡
2. 动态网站(PHP/Python/Node.js + 数据库)
- 如果是 WordPress、Django、Flask 等框架搭建的网站
- 每个网站都要运行后端服务 + 数据库(比如 MySQL)
- 访问量稍大(比如每分钟几十个请求),就会出现资源紧张
| 在这种情况下: | 情况 | 是否会卡 |
|---|---|---|
| 两个低流量网站(每天几百访问) | 不会卡,可以正常运行 | |
| 一个中等流量 + 一个低流量 | 偶尔卡顿,需要优化 | |
| 两个中高流量网站(每天几千访问) | 明显卡顿,建议升级配置 |
✅ 二、服务器负载的关键点
| 组件 | 影响因素 |
|---|---|
| CPU | 后端逻辑复杂、大量计算任务 |
| 内存 | 多个服务进程占用、缓存、数据库连接 |
| 磁盘IO | 静态文件多、频繁读写数据库 |
| 网络带宽 | 图片视频多、并发访问多 |
✅ 三、如何判断是否“卡”?
你可以通过以下方式监控服务器状态:
top # 查看整体CPU/内存使用情况
htop # 更好看的top(需安装)
free -h # 查看内存使用
df -h # 查看磁盘空间
iotop # 查看磁盘IO(需安装)
如果你发现:
- CPU 使用率经常超过 80%
- 内存使用接近或超过 4GB
- 页面加载明显变慢、响应时间长
➡️ 那就是“卡了”
✅ 四、优化建议(如果卡的话)
-
合理分配资源
- 两个网站部署在同一台 Nginx/Apache 下,共享 Web 服务
- 共享数据库(避免两个数据库各自占用内存)
-
启用缓存
- 使用 Redis 或 Memcached 缓存热点数据
- 对 WordPress 可以加对象缓存插件
-
压缩与 CDN
- 开启 Gzip 压缩
- 使用 CDN 提速静态资源(图片、CSS、JS)
-
限制并发连接数
- 防止恶意刷站或突发访问拖垮服务器
-
考虑升级配置
- 如果长期负载高,建议升级到 2核8G 或 4核8G
✅ 总结
| 场景 | 是否卡 |
|---|---|
| 两个静态网站 | ❌ 不卡 |
| 两个低流量动态网站 | ❌ 基本不卡 |
| 一个中流量 + 一个低流量网站 | ⚠️ 有时卡 |
| 两个中高流量网站 | ✅ 很容易卡 |
如果你能提供更详细的信息(比如网站类型、访问量、技术栈),我可以给你更精准的建议 😊
CLOUD云